Output 21e75900a399252edc1776c0b72647ea80ef38adcb081b1ff827529cf0019b42:0

value
1000906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 140a92400f3182d9d607169ce3ab7ff3f897691b OP_EQUAL
address
33Wz6tNKoPMUZpfJQWPso52DcwwS7teuHq
transaction
21e75900a399252edc1776c0b72647ea80ef38adcb081b1ff827529cf0019b42
spent
true